Key legal question
Whether the federal appeal met the statutory reasoning requirements and was admissible
Extracted holding
The appeal did not contain a sufficient legal reasoning showing how the cantonal judgment violated federal law; the Court therefore could not enter into the merits.
Extracted reasoning
The appellant failed to meet the strict requirements of Art. 42 and 106 BGG, and her criticisms of the facts and qualification of her submissions were not substantiated in a way that would justify review under Art. 105 and 97 BGG.
